I’m often asked how we go about using web analytics to really pinpoint problems that make the tools worth the investment. Many people are dubious when asked to fork out 50,000 a year to have reports about how people visit their website. This article will describe how to use a key performance indicator to raise the problem and then go onto describe how to find out what the issue is on the website.
